On February 20, 2018 ncbnews.com ran a story titled "Poll: Support for gun control hits record high." This article references a survey performed by Quinnipiac University of 1,351 voters nationwide and of those sampled 883 stated that they want stricter gun control laws. Assume that the survey utilized a random sample of all Americans. You are going to compute and thoroughly interpret a 95% confidence interval for the proportion of all Americans that want stricter gun control laws. Calculate the standard error for this confidence interval (round to four decimal spots).
